Types of SEO Services
On-page SEO
This refers to the optimization of website elements such as content, images, and meta tags, enhancing relevance and readability.
Off-page SEO
Off-page SEO involves tactics executed outside of your website, primarily focusing on building high-quality backlinks to enhance domain authority.
Technical SEO
Entailing the optimization of website architecture, Technical SEO aims to improve crawling and indexing efficiency.
Local SEO
Specializing in optimizing for local searches, Local SEO targets geographic-based keywords and local business listings.

Keywords: The Pillars of SEO
Long-tail vs Short-tail Keywords
Long-tail keywords are specific and less competitive, whereas short-tail keywords are general and highly competitive.
Keyword Research Tools
Tools like Google Keyword Planner and SEMrush facilitate comprehensive keyword analysis.
Placement and Density
Strategic placement and density of keywords in content enhances visibility without risking keyword stuffing penalties.

Backlinking Strategies
Significance of Backlinks
Backlinks act as endorsements, enhancing the domain authority of a website.
White Hat vs Black Hat Techniques
White Hat techniques comply with search engine guidelines, while Black Hat techniques risk penalties.
Tools for Backlink Analysis
Software like Ahrefs and Moz provide comprehensive backlink analytics.
